Decoding the Altcoin Season Index: What Does 25 Mean?

The **Altcoin Season Index** provides a clear metric. It measures the performance of the top 100 cryptocurrencies. This calculation excludes stablecoins and wrapped tokens. The index compares their price performance against Bitcoin over the last 90 days. A score of 75 or higher indicates an **Altcoin Season**. This means 75% of these top coins have outperformed Bitcoin. Conversely, a score below 75 often suggests a Bitcoin-dominated period. Therefore, a score of 25 points to strong Bitcoin performance. It shows many altcoins have struggled to keep pace. This current figure reflects a significant lean towards Bitcoin’s market leadership. It impacts overall **crypto market trends**.

Historical Cycles of Altcoin Season and Market Shifts

Cryptocurrency markets are notoriously cyclical. Historically, periods of **Bitcoin dominance** give way to an **Altcoin Season**. These cycles are a recurring feature. Early investors remember significant altcoin surges. For example, 2017 and parts of 2021 saw massive altcoin rallies. During these times, many **digital assets** experienced parabolic growth. New projects emerged and gained substantial traction. The **Altcoin Season Index** would have registered high scores then. These periods often follow a strong Bitcoin bull run. Bitcoin typically leads the charge, establishing new price highs. Subsequently, profits often rotate into altcoins. This rotation fuels their growth. Analyzing these past patterns helps anticipate future shifts. However, past performance does not guarantee future results.

Factors Driving Altcoin Performance and Market Trends

Several factors influence the potential for an **Altcoin Season**. Technological innovation plays a key role. Breakthroughs in scaling solutions or new decentralized applications can boost specific altcoins. Regulatory clarity also provides a significant catalyst. Positive news regarding crypto regulations can attract institutional capital. This capital often flows into diverse **digital assets**. Furthermore, macro-economic conditions affect the entire **crypto market trends**. High inflation or interest rate changes can impact investor risk appetite. This directly influences investment in more volatile altcoins. Finally, community development and adoption are crucial. Strong communities drive utility and demand for various projects. These elements collectively shape market sentiment. They dictate whether altcoins gain traction against Bitcoin.

1. What is the Altcoin Season Index?
The Altcoin Season Index is a metric from CoinMarketCap. It measures the performance of the top 100 cryptocurrencies (excluding stablecoins and wrapped tokens) against Bitcoin over the past 90 days. It helps determine if the market favors altcoins or Bitcoin.

2. What does an Altcoin Season Index score of 25 signify?
A score of 25 means that only 25% of the top 100 altcoins have outperformed Bitcoin in the last 90 days. This indicates a period of strong Bitcoin dominance. It suggests many altcoins are struggling to gain value relative to Bitcoin.

3. How is an Altcoin Season declared?
An Altcoin Season is declared when the Altcoin Season Index reaches 75 or higher. This signifies that 75% or more of the top 100 altcoins have outperformed Bitcoin over the preceding 90 days.
